The 3M 7100079150 is a non-woven surface conditioning belt designed for wide-belt grinding and finishing applications across metalworking and fabrication environments. Built on a durable cloth and polyester scrim backing, this belt delivers moderate stretch resistance, making it well-suited for low-stretch machine configurations. The open web construction resists loading, extending service life even under sustained use. Springy non-woven nylon fibers conform to workpiece geometry while finishing surfaces without aggressive stock removal, reducing the risk of marring or distorting the substrate. This belt is intended for wide-format surface conditioning applications where controlled finishing is required without cutting aggressively into the base material. It performs across a range of substrates including stainless steel and brass, making it a practical choice for shops processing multiple material types in sequence. The aluminum oxide mineral and resin bond construction are suited to general-purpose deburring, blending, and finishing operations on flat or contoured workpieces run through belt grinder or wide-belt sander setups.
Designed as a wide-belt surface conditioning replacement for standard belt grinder and wide-belt sander machines accepting 75 inch by 36 inch non-woven abrasive belts.
Belt installation should be performed by a qualified machine operator or maintenance technician following the equipment manufacturer's belt-change procedure. Disconnect and lock out all power to the machine before removing or installing the belt. Confirm belt tracking and tension per machine specifications before resuming operation. Inspect the belt and machine platens or contact drums for wear or damage at each changeout.
